- (Source: bonnebluadded this on 30 Jun 2008) "Evidently, Thomas Bauman, was a rebel of sorts. He left his family in Oklahoma, leaving them to fend for themselves, moved to English, Indiana, and married another woman. I have been unable to find this 2nd "wife." On September 24, 1898, Thomas was arrested for bigamy, went to court, and served about 1 year in jail for the offense. While I have not found any records to indicate the location, I suspect Corydon, Indiana, is where any records of this arrest would be found."
